About this role:
Wells Fargo is seeking a Fiduciary Manager as part of the Trust Account Opening and Maintenance team within Wealth and Investment Management Operations. This team supports the account opening process for Wells Fargo trust accounts and serves as an escalation point for trust officers, financial advisors and clients. The team is also responsible for day-to-day asset maintenance, providing account governance and reporting and meeting compliance standards set by regulators.
The Fiduciary Manager will manage a team of senior fiduciary specialists while ensuring the firm's trust and agency account administration and best-in-class trust services experience for advisors and clients. Additionally, the manager will drive process improvement and risk control development to ensure trust account services are managed consistently. In this role, you will:
Manage and develop a team senior fiduciary specialists with moderate complexity and risk in Fiduciary Management Services, promoting growth, profit management, and risk management
Engage stakeholders and partners within the Trust Services functional area
Assign accounts and ensure relationships are managed according to fiduciary policies and procedures to ensure satisfactory audits and service standards
Identify and recommend opportunities for process improvement and risk control development within the Fiduciary Management Services office
Lead team in new business-related efforts and acquisitions, retain or expand current relationships and coach on business development investment strategies
Review documents, negotiate fees, and approve discretionary distributions up to appropriate amount
Make decisions and resolve issues regarding objectives and operations of Fiduciary Management Services team to meet business objectives
Implement estate plans and collaborate with investment and risk partners to ensure compliance with relevant laws and regulations
Provide fiduciary oversight and answer moderately complex questions regarding trust taxability, document interpretation, and fiduciary risk management
Collaborate with Trust Services leadership, risk partners and other regional leaders to ensure consistent execution and quality of service
Manage allocation of people and financial resources for Fiduciary Products
Mentor and guide talent development of direct reports and assist in hiring talent
